Your wife is wrong. I work in a large store. We can't get some of these high volume items like TP right now. The last 2 weeks we have done just about double our sales from what we would typically do this time of year. We are not alone l, as most stores around here have similiar increases. So that means the warehouses are going through twice as much stuff. They have to order things weeks in advance from suppliers. So they are going along making product at their normal rate and all of a sudden you get this huge surge in demand that nobody saw coming which leads to outs. Believe me if we could get the products, it'd be on the shelf
This would be similar to you set up for feeding 100 head and you wake up next morning you go to your barn and you have 200 head but you still only have feed/ bedding/ etc for 100.
